Joe Coleman is a writer for BestReviews who frequently focuses on backpacking, travel, and running. Joe earned a Bachelor of Arts in Philosophy from Loyola Marymount University before working as a journalist and radio personality in Western Alaska. His love for (and obsession with) backpacking started when he moved to the Pacific Northwest, living next to Olympic National Park in Washington. As for globetrotting, he feels he’s mastered the art of cheap flights and one-bag travel.
